Leaf is a local-first, privacy-focused note-taking app for desktop built with Electron, Vue 3, and TypeScript. Inspired by Obsidian and LM Studio, Leaf provides a clean, distraction-free environment for managing your notes with local AI capabilities. All your data stays on your device - no cloud, no database, no tracking.

IMPORTANT: This app runs natively on Desktop (macOS, Windows, Linux). All notes are stored in your local vault folder and never leave your device.

Features

Note Management

  • Vault-based system - Select any folder as your vault
  • Multi-format support - Read and edit .txt and .md (Markdown) files
  • Image support - View images directly in the app (.png, .jpg, .jpeg, .gif, .webp, .svg, .bmp, .ico)
  • Video support - Play videos directly in the app (.mp4, .webm, .ogg, .mov, .avi, .mkv)
  • Audio support - Play audio files directly in the app (.mp3, .wav, .flac, .aac, .m4a, .ogg, .wma, .aiff)
  • Audio recording - Record voice notes directly in the app and save as .wav files to your vault
  • Speech-to-text dictation - Dictate into .txt and .md files using local Whisper speech recognition — no cloud, no API keys
  • File browser - Navigate your notes with a tree-based folder structure
  • Obsidian-style media embeds - Use ![[image.png]] syntax in Markdown to embed images, videos, audio, and PDFs inline — fully interoperable with Obsidian vaults
  • Drag & drop embed - Drag media files from the file explorer onto a Markdown note to automatically insert embed syntax
  • Drag & drop organization - Move files between folders with drag and drop
  • Folder nesting - Organize folders by dragging them into other folders
  • Auto-save - Changes save automatically as you type

AI Assistant (Local LLM)

  • 100% local inference - Run AI models directly on your machine, no cloud or API keys needed
  • In-app model download - Search and download GGUF models directly from Hugging Face without leaving the app
  • Smart model info - See file size, quantization type, estimated RAM usage, and size tier badges before downloading
  • Chat interface - Built-in chat panel with streaming responses
  • Conversation history - All chats are automatically saved as JSON and can be browsed, loaded, renamed, or deleted
  • Conversation restore - Reloading a model or switching conversations automatically restores context so the AI remembers what you discussed
  • Auto context compaction - When token memory reaches 90%, the AI automatically summarizes the conversation and frees context space — no data is lost, all messages stay visible
  • Note-aware context - Toggle to include the current note as context for AI queries
  • Agent mode - Let the AI read and edit your currently open file directly, with built-in version control (approve or revert every change)
  • Model management - Load and unload GGUF models from a dedicated models folder (~/leaf-models/)
  • GPU accelerated - Automatically uses Metal (macOS), CUDA (NVIDIA), or Vulkan for fast inference
  • Powered by llama.cpp - Uses node-llama-cpp bindings to llama.cpp (both MIT licensed)

AI Models

Leaf stores AI models in ~/leaf-models/. To get started with the AI assistant:

  1. Open the AI panel by clicking the lightbulb icon in the sidebar
  2. Click the download icon in the toolbar to open the Hugging Face download panel
  3. Search for a model (e.g. "llama 3.2", "phi", "qwen") and browse available GGUF files
  4. Check the size tier badge and estimated RAM to make sure it fits your machine
  5. Click the download button — the model is saved directly to ~/leaf-models/
  6. Select and load the model from the dropdown in the AI panel

Tip: You can also manually place .gguf files in ~/leaf-models/ or click the folder icon to open the directory.

Using Agent Mode

Agent mode lets the AI edit your files directly with a safety net:

  1. Open a file in the editor
  2. Open the AI panel and load a model
  3. Click the Agent mode button (code brackets icon) in the toolbar — the indicator shows the current file name
  4. Ask the AI to make changes (e.g. "add a table of contents" or "refactor the second paragraph")
  5. The AI proposes edits shown as inline diff cards with Approve and Reject buttons
  6. Approve keeps the change permanently; Reject reverts the file to its original content

Agent mode only operates on the currently open file and is scoped to your vault folder for security.

Using Dictation (Speech-to-Text)

Leaf includes a built-in speech-to-text feature powered by Whisper running 100% locally via ONNX:

  1. Open any .txt or .md file in the editor
  2. Click the microphone icon in the bottom-right corner of the editor
  3. On first use, the Whisper model loads from disk (a few seconds)
  4. Speak naturally — your speech is transcribed and appended to the file every ~5 seconds
  5. Click the microphone again to stop dictation

Speech-to-Text Model Setup

The app uses Xenova/whisper-tiny.en from Hugging Face. Download the two required ONNX files and place them at the exact paths shown:

models/whisper/Xenova/whisper-tiny.en/onnx/encoder_model.onnx
models/whisper/Xenova/whisper-tiny.en/onnx/decoder_model_merged.onnx

Recommended models for getting started:

Model Size RAM Needed Best For
Llama 3.2 1B Q4 ~0.7 GB ~2 GB Fast, lightweight tasks
Llama 3.2 3B Q4 ~2 GB ~4 GB Good balance of speed and quality
Phi-3 Mini 3.8B Q4 ~2.3 GB ~4 GB Strong reasoning
Llama 3.1 8B Q4 ~4.5 GB ~8 GB Best quality

Conversation History

AI conversations are automatically saved as JSON files in Electron's standard userData directory:

  • macOS: ~/Library/Application Support/Leaf/conversations/
  • Windows: %APPDATA%\Leaf\conversations\
  • Linux: ~/.config/Leaf/conversations/

Each conversation is stored as a separate .json file containing the model used, timestamps, and the full message history. Conversations are auto-titled from the first message and can be renamed or deleted from the history panel.
